HCQUIN 200 mg Tablet contains hydroxychloroquine sulphate, a
medication commonly used for the treatment and prevention of malaria as well as
certain autoimmune conditions. It belongs to a group of medicines known as
antimalarial agents.
Hydroxychloroquine is also prescribed in some cases to help
manage autoimmune disorders where the immune system mistakenly attacks the
body’s own tissues. These conditions may include rheumatoid arthritis and
lupus.

Active Ingredient
The active ingredient is Hydroxychloroquine Sulphate.
Hydroxychloroquine works by interfering with the growth of
parasites responsible for malaria and by modulating immune system activity in
autoimmune diseases.
Uses of HCQUIN 200 mg Tablet
Common uses include:
• Treatment of malaria
• Prevention of malaria infection
• Management of autoimmune conditions
• Supportive therapy in rheumatoid arthritis and lupus
How HCQUIN Tablet Works
Hydroxychloroquine works by inhibiting parasite growth
inside red blood cells. In autoimmune conditions, it helps regulate immune
system responses and reduce inflammation.

Possible Side Effects
Possible side effects include:
• Nausea
• Stomach discomfort
• Headache
• Dizziness
